Learn how to start seeds and create a beautiful flower border for your yard in this hands-on class. We will focus on plants that attract pollinators, butterflies, hummingbirds, and spectacular moths. With conservation in mind, we will also discuss some clever techniques and ideas to help enhance any spot in your yard. Each participant will take home three windowsill flats with a mix of annual and perennial seeds. This is a great class for beginner gardeners.
